Research on the Stability of Directional Drilling through Rock

Publication: ICPTT 2012: Better Pipeline Infrastructure for a Better Life

Abstract

With construction of long-distance pipeline in China, the horizontal directional drilling of many pipeline is often through the rock, and the stability of the drilling is the key factor that pipeline successful pass through the rock. On the basis of previous experiences in engineering, the various factors of affecting stability were analyzed from rock mechanics point of view in this paper, including the in-situ rock stress and the hole fluid pressure and so on. Moreover, the formula of hole fluid pressure was deduced according to the compression-shear pressure and tension-fracture pressure, and an evaluation of the directional drilling through the rock mass stability criterion was established ultimately. This research can lay the foundation for theoretical studies of similar projects and it is guidance for practical engineering.
